Accidents are hard to restrict and smartphones are always at risk of getting damaged. As days are passing by we are increasingly becoming dependent on use of smartphones. These useful devices have made our lives simpler. Yet they are susceptible to damage. One of the commonest among damages which a smartphone is likely to experience is a shattered screen. Not only does it make your phone appear unimpressive but at the same time makes the device unusable and at some instances, dangerous to use. Besides, the different types of internal mechanisms of the phone too, get affected due to screen damage.

The facts you should know

The phone’s screen is vital. It’s one of those primary components which allow you to operate the device. Although major smartphone sellers like Samsung, Nokia and Apple are equipping their products with stronger screens, it’s hard to ignore the fact that they are not unbreakable. Even if unfortunately the device experiences screen damage, some users may feel like backing out from the decision of handing over the smartphone to the repair shop. What they do not realise is the fact that laying inexperienced hands on a screen repair or a replacement job can cause potential damage. Although some companies are providing kits for screen repair, chances of further damage brought upon by handling the problem incorrectly cannot be ruled out by any chance. That’s why it is vital to get such crucial component repaired or replaced by professionals only.

Its proven, DIY options are too risky. The devices are intricate and demand precision and tools. If you are still not convinced here are pitfalls concerning DIY screen repair which you may not be aware of:

DIY brings along with it a huge amount of risk

When you are trying to lay your hands on a DIY process it’s likely that you will risk your entire data which is definitely not worth losing. That’s why we recommend you get in touch with professionals who will be able to deliver a successful screen repair and replacement. Besides, you can imagine the pain of hurting yourself with tiny tools or the shards which might prick you any time in your oblivion.

You are not at a gainer’s end

DIY is undoubtedly cheaper than seeking professional services. But how much can you save on a DIY project? Almost $50! Do you think it’s worth risking your data, files and efforts which you are going to put into fixing the problem?

Finding the correct component may seem tough

Replacing or repairing the smartphone screen is not a cake walk. There are different parts involved in the process. Novices may find it extremely challenging to find these parts. Some manufacturers literally make it difficult for users to find parts separately. While some parts may be available others may take huge time to procure.

In order to avoid getting into the mess first back out from the idea of trying the screen repair and replacement process on your own. Instead, you should simply head straight to the repair shop.
